Hi -

My RO/DI unit arrived today (yay!!). It came with an adapter to attach to a garden hose, but it doesn't fit any of the faucets in my apartment (and the outside hose attachment at my place is turned off for the winter). What do I do? I have no idea how to get it hooked up to a water supply at this point! :frustrat:

Thanks!
 
Best way is to bring to local plumbing shop as there are many different sizes of connections. Bring (or show a picture of the connection type) and they can give you the appropriate adapter. If you are a handy DIY, you could probably tap directly into a water line (but that can be tricky)

Not to worry- plumbing or hardware store should have the appropriate connection in stock

last pic is my sink with the aerator taken out
then the washer that came on top of aerator , notice the lip.. it sits inside the lip of it and goes over the top to create a water tight seal
then 6 pics of the adapter i bought at my local ace hardware, one side fits into the sink, and the other fits into the plastic adapter for the outside hose... it has a washer in it but there is room for the first washer i showed you... the first washer will sit inside the adapter and on the top, i tried every other thing imaginable and my unit leaked like Niagara. this works 100% never had a leak sense. you can see what i am talking about with combining the two washers in the 3rd to last pic, see how the washer sits on top of the whole thing... then you just assemble it all together and wala! you go RO
